Gender: Boy
Meaning: Shield wolf or rim of a shield
Origin: Old English/Old Norse
Popularity: Ranked #1604 in 2024 with 106 babies born.
History: Randall is a form of Randolph, from the Old Norse 'Randúlfr,' combining 'rand' (rim of a shield) and 'úlfr' (wolf). It was a common medieval English name, particularly in its surname form. It became a popular given name in 20th-century America.
Name length: 7 letters
How common is Randall? About 1 in 31,401 babies born in 2024 were named Randall, or roughly 0.3 per day in the United States.
